Is red color a new trend in smartphones?Korea It definitely seems like it's catching on; months after Apple launched a special edition (RED) iPhone, a new leak shows a red variant of HTC's upcoming flagship, the HTC U.
The phone, which is slated for a May 16 launch, was so far only seen in blue. And the photo, coming from an official HTC teaser video, wasn't the highest quality.
The new leaks, courtesy of (usually pretty reliable) Onleaks (the actual source seems to be 91mobiles), show the phone from all sides and in higher resolution.
The phone, seen in a render allegedly based on factory CAD drawings, looks pretty common for today's standards -- curved edges but a flat screen, with a home button below the screen and a single camera on the back.

According to previous leaks and hints from HTC itself, the phone will respond to squeezes -- you'll be able to perform actions by squeezing its sides. We're looking forward to see how this new approach works in practice.
As far as rest of the specs go, the phone is rumored to have a 12-megapixel camera, a 3,000mAh battery, 4/6GB of RAM and 64/128 GB of storage.
